Demolition debris hauling services involve the removal and disposal of debris generated from demolition projects, renovations, or construction work. When a property owner in Lakeland, FL, or nearby areas undertakes a building demolition or significant remodeling, they often end up with large quantities of rubble, broken concrete, wood, drywall, and other debris. Professional service providers handle the cleanup by loading, hauling away, and disposing of these materials efficiently, helping to clear the site and prepare it for the next phase of construction or landscaping. This service ensures that debris is managed safely and responsibly, reducing the risk of clutter and potential hazards on the property.
This type of hauling service helps solve common problems such as overcrowded work sites, legal compliance issues related to waste disposal, and the need for efficient cleanup after demolition. Without proper removal, debris can block access, create safety hazards, and lead to fines or delays if not properly managed. The overview below groups typical Demolition Debris Hauling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lakeland,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or demolition debris removal,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600 for many smaller jobs. These projects often involve clearing out debris from small-scale demolition or renovation work. Costs can vary based on debris volume and access conditions.
Medium-Sized Projects - Larger jobs such as partial demolition or debris hauling from medium-scale projects usually fall in the range of $600 to $2,000. Many routine jobs land in this middle range, depending on the amount of debris and site complexity.
Large or Complex Jobs - Extensive demolition debris removal, like full building tear-downs or large renovation cleanups, can cost $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, which often involves significant debris volume or challenging site conditions.
Full Demolition & Disposal - Complete demolition projects with substantial debris can reach $5,000+ depending on size and scope. Local service providers can handle these larger jobs, but costs tend to be on the higher end due to debris volume and disposal requ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
